School Officials

Volume 52: debated on Thursday 1 May 1913

The text on this page has been created from Hansard archive content, it may contain typographical errors.

7.

asked whether the thirteen lay officials of the Trim district school come under the National Insurance Act or are they entitled to pensions; and, if they are excluded in both cases, how are they provided for in case any of them are obliged to resign through ill-health?

These officials are not regarded as coming within the National Insurance Act, nor are they entitled to pensions. There does not, therefore, appear to be provision made for them in the event of their retirement through ill-health.
